Yes, ASM IMCOST does offer a Bachelor of Commerce (BCom) at the undergraduate level. The UG-level programme is affiliated with the University of Mumbai and is offered in a full-time mode lasting for three years. The BCom course is spread across six semesters and covers essential subjects such as accounting, finance, economics, business law, and management. Further, the college offers BCom courses in three specialisations i.e., BCom in Accounting and Finance, BCom in Banking and Insurance and BCom in Financial Market.

The eligibility criteria for ASM IMCOST BCom course admission includes qualifying the Class 12 from CBSE 12th, Maharashtra HSC and other recognised boards of education. Additionally, candidates should have studied Class 12 from the Commerce stream and secure at least an aggregate of 50%. ASM Institute of Management and Computer Studies also accept the entrance scores for admissions.

Both the BCom and BBA LLB are excellent programs with benefits and drawbacks of their own. The course that is perfect for you will rely on your unique interests and objectives. BBA LLB is a fantastic choice if a legal career is something you're interested in. Your degree in both business and law will offer you an advantage in the employment market.BCom might be a better choice, though, if you are unsure of whether you want to follow a legal career. If candidate decide that law is not for him/her, it will be simpler to alter the mind because BCom is a shorter course and less expensive.

The BCom fee at Dr Bhim Rao Ambedkar College, DU ranges from INR 40,360 to INR 43,660. On the other hand, the fee for BCom at Zakir Hussain Delhi College ranges between INR 35,700 - INR 38,400. Based on the given fee range, Zakir Hussain Delhi College seems to be a more economical options for pursuing BCom. NOTE: The mentioned fee is sourced from the official websites of the institutes/sanctioning bodies. It is still subject to change and hence, is indicative.
